ISO 15848-2:2015 specifies test procedures for the evaluation of external leakage of valve stems or shafts and body joints of isolating valves and control valves intended for application with volatile air pollutants and hazardous fluids. End connection joints, vacuum application, effects of corrosion, and radiation are excluded from this part of ISO 15848. The production acceptance test is intended for standard production valves where fugitive emissions standards are specified.

Overview
EN ISO 15848-2:2015 - Industrial valves: Measurement, test and qualification procedures for fugitive emissions - Part 2: Production acceptance test of valves - defines the production-level test procedures to verify external leakage from valve stems/shafts and body joints of isolating and control valves for use with volatile air pollutants and hazardous fluids. It is the production acceptance complement to ISO 15848-1 (type testing and classification) and was published by CEN in 2015.
Key topics and requirements
- Scope & exclusions: Applies to external leakage of stems/shafts and body seals of isolating and control valves. Excludes end connection joints, vacuum applications, corrosion and radiation effects.
- Sampling: Lot sampling percentage is by agreement between manufacturer and purchaser, with a minimum of one valve per lot selected at random.
- Preconditioning: Valves must be of a design already successfully type-tested according to ISO 15848-1 and conform to relevant production tests prior to this acceptance test.
- Test fluid: Helium with a minimum purity of 97% by volume.
- Leakage measurement: Per the sniffing method defined in ISO 15848-1:2015, Annex B, reported in ppmv.
- Test conditions: Default test pressure 6 bar (unless otherwise agreed) and room temperature as defined in ISO 15848-1.
- Stem/shaft leakage procedure:
- Half-open valve, pressurize to test pressure, measure by sniffing.
- Cycle valve (fully open/close) five times under pressure.
- Half-open and re-measure. If leakage exceeds the agreed tightness class, the valve fails.
- Tightness classes (stem seals):
- Class A ≤ 50 ppmv
- Class B ≤ 100 ppmv
- Class C ≤ 200 ppmv
- Body seal requirement: Measured leakage must be ≤ 50 ppmv (sniffing method).
- Marking & certification: Only valves tested and qualified per ISO 15848-1 and compliant with Part 2 may be marked. Manufacturer shall provide a certificate of compliance if requested.
Practical applications
- Ensures production valves meet specified fugitive emissions limits for environmental, safety and regulatory compliance in petrochemical, oil & gas, chemical processing and other industries handling volatile/hazardous fluids.
- Used during final production inspection, factory acceptance tests (FAT), and supply contracts to verify stem/shaft and body joint tightness before shipping.
- Supports leak-reduction programs, emissions reporting, and alignment with environmental permitting that requires demonstrated control of fugitive emissions.
Who uses this standard
- Valve manufacturers and quality/control engineers conducting production acceptance tests
- Purchasing/specification engineers, procurement teams and end-users who require certified low-emission valves
- Third-party inspection bodies and compliance auditors verifying conformance with fugitive emission requirements
